Kindernet has welcomed a new long-term strategic partner
July 2026 — Kindernet, a Netherlands-based childcare provider with 40 preschool and after-school care locations, has joined forces with a leading European education group to further strengthen the quality and availability of childcare in the evolving Dutch childcare market.
Founded in 2011, Kindernet provides daycare and after-school care services, offering more than 1,400 childcare places. Through a combination of organic expansion and strategic acquisitions, the company has grown into a leading regional childcare platform in the eastern Netherlands. Kindernet is committed to corporate social responsibility and actively supports a broad range of social initiatives focused on long-term impact and meaningful community engagement.

Educbank has been acquired by Cogna
Cogna Educação, through its subsidiary Somos Sistemas de Ensino, has acquired an additional 47% stake in Educbank for approximately US$8.9 million, increasing its ownership from 43% to 90% and consolidating control of the platform. The transaction expands Cogna’s presence beyond its traditional enrollment-driven education business into the financial infrastructure that underpins school tuition collection.
